Well, I’mma not much of a reviewer so rarely go back, edit the post and put some thoughts down. But okay, the 6102R was a good smoke. There were different flavors that I couldn’t identify (…no surprise there…) and strength was definitely Med-Full. I got them on sale from a small place on the Left Coast and with my Reward Points, was able to get them for under $10. I’ve had them for almost 8 weeks so thought it was time to ash one up.

Good construction, cold draw was a little tight so I rolled the cigar in between my hands to, hopefully, loosen it up. It worked to a small extent, good enough to get to the lighting stage. Lots of smoke output and spot-on, even burn. As usual when I’m outside smoking, I’m doing other things so didn’t really pay attention to stuff like transitions but thought there were at least a couple, maybe 3 of them.

Overall a nice experience and looking forward to my next one in a few more months.
